Book Overview

Mesmer and his Disciples is a book written by Frank Podmore that delves into the life and practices of Franz Anton Mesmer, an 18th-century physician who developed a theory of animal magnetism that he believed could cure various ailments. The book also explores the influence of Mesmer's ideas on his disciples, who continued to develop and promote his theories long after his death. Podmore examines the scientific and cultural context in which Mesmer worked, including the influence of Enlightenment thought and the rise of spiritualism. The book also includes detailed accounts of Mesmer's treatments, which involved the use of magnets and other tools to manipulate the body's energy fields. Overall, Mesmer and his Disciples provides a fascinating insight into a little-known chapter of medical history and the enduring legacy of Mesmer's ideas.THIS 22 PAGE ARTICLE WAS EXTRACTED FROM THE BOOK: Mediums of the 19th Century Part 1, by Frank Podmore.
